I was describing a Rochester Model B. The Carter uses a metering rod to richen the mixture as the throttle is opened, instead of a power valve. You can bend the linkage a little to lean the mixture, by withdrawing the metering rod less for any particular throttle opening. According to my Motor manual, there is a special gauge to check the metering rod setting, so without it, any adjustment will involve a little guesswork.
